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Downtown Rogers Farmers Market (Rogers, AR)
The Downtown Rogers Farmers Market is centrally located in the heart of Rogers, Arkansas, a growing city in the northwest corner of the state. Situated just off the main thoroughfare of Walnut Street, the market benefits from easy access and visibility. Major highways like I-49 provide direct routes into Rogers, with the market itself being a short drive from the interstate exit ramps. Parking is available on surrounding streets and in nearby public lots, though it can become busy on market days. For those flying in, Northwest Arkansas National Airport (XNA) is approximately a 20-minute drive to the west, offering convenient access via Highway 12. Public transportation options in Rogers are limited, making personal vehicles or rideshare services the most common modes of transport for reaching the market. Strategic arrival is key; aim to arrive either early in the morning to beat the crowds or slightly later to experience the full bustle. Understanding the local traffic flow, especially on Saturdays, will help ensure a smooth journey to this community cornerstone.

Event Day Flow
Arrival & Pre-Event
Plan to arrive at the market in the early morning, ideally between 8:00 AM and 9:00 AM, especially on Saturdays when it's most popular. This window allows you to experience the market at its peak vibrancy with a wide selection of fresh produce and artisanal goods. Street parking is generally available in the blocks surrounding the market at this time, though some dedicated public lots also serve the area. Familiarize yourself with the layout before diving in; take a quick walk around the perimeter to get a feel for the vendors and attractions. Grab a coffee from a nearby cafe or a pre-market snack to fuel your exploration.
During the Event
As the morning progresses, the market will become more crowded, with a lively atmosphere and increased foot traffic. This is the perfect time to engage with local vendors, learn about their products, and sample offerings. Many vendors accept cash, but it’s wise to carry some smaller bills, though card readers are becoming more common. Keep an eye on your belongings in denser areas. If you plan to purchase larger items or perishables, consider bringing a reusable bag or basket to easily carry your finds. Take breaks at one of the nearby benches or cafes to enjoy your purchases or simply observe the scene.
Post-Event & Departure
The farmers market typically winds down around noon or 1:00 PM. If you plan to stay and explore the rest of downtown Rogers, this is an ideal time to transition to lunch or visit local shops. Parking might become more challenging to find directly adjacent to the market as it closes, so be prepared to walk a block or two if you've stayed late. If departing Rogers, allow extra time for potential traffic congestion on main roads, especially if leaving during peak lunch hours. Downtown Rogers · On siteDaisy Airgun Museum
Delve into a piece of American history at the Daisy Airgun Museum, located right in the heart of downtown Rogers. This unique museum celebrates the iconic Daisy BB gun, a childhood staple for generations. Explore exhibits detailing the company's heritage, its impact on pop culture, and the evolution of its products. It’s a nostalgic and engaging experience for all ages, offering a glimpse into a classic American brand. The museum’s central location makes it an easy and quick stop after visiting the farmers market, providing a dose of local heritage.

Weather & Seasons at Downtown Rogers Farmers Market
- Winter: Winter in Rogers brings cold temperatures, with average highs in the 40s and lows dipping into the 20s. Snowfall is possible but not guaranteed, often melting quickly. Heavy coats, gloves, and hats are essential for outdoor comfort. Indoor activities like the Daisy Airgun Museum or Rogers Activity Center are ideal, and dining focuses on warm, hearty meals.
- Spring & early summer: Spring begins with mild temperatures, gradually warming into pleasant, sometimes warm, conditions by early summer. Expect average highs in the 60s and 70s. Light jackets or sweaters are useful for cooler mornings and evenings. This is prime time for the farmers market, with a focus on fresh produce and outdoor activities like visiting Lake Atalanta.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er brings heat and humidity, with average highs frequently in the 90s and occasional heatwaves pushing temperatures even higher. Lightweight, breathable clothing is a must. Sunscreen, hats, and hydration are crucial for any outdoor exploration, including the farmers market. Early morning visits are highly recommended to avoid the peak heat.
- Fall season: Fall offers a welcome reprieve from summer heat, with crisp air and comfortable temperatures. Average highs range from the 70s in early fall to the 50s by late season. Layers are key, with sweaters and light jackets being practical. This season is ideal for exploring downtown, enjoying the farmers market's harvest bounty, and taking advantage of outdoor trails.
- Rain & snow: Rain is possible throughout the year, but more frequent in spring and fall. Snow is less common and typically does not accumulate significantly. Always check the forecast before heading out; an umbrella or waterproof jacket is advisable. For market days, plan for potential dampness or slick surfaces. Indoor options are always a good backup.
